Output 51caaf12e4246ffc9c23b02f2a735a4e795f3ad2a9335b91b89b83da95ae396f:1

value
9517376
script pubkey
OP_0 OP_PUSHBYTES_20 abe1de2d461b2119b87685c63f1b149f3ae0161d
address
ltc1q40saut2xrvs3nwrkshrr7xc5nuawq9sayxymd9
transaction
51caaf12e4246ffc9c23b02f2a735a4e795f3ad2a9335b91b89b83da95ae396f
spent
true